SubjectRe: [PATCH] swiotlb: add overflow checks to swiotlb_bounce
On Wed, Jul 07, 2021 at 02:12:54PM +0900, Dominique Martinet wrote:
> This is a follow-up on 5f89468e2f06 ("swiotlb: manipulate orig_addr
> when tlb_addr has offset") which fixed unaligned dma mappings,
> making sure the following overflows are caught:
>
> - offset of the start of the slot within the device bigger than
> requested address' offset, in other words if the base address
> given in swiotlb_tbl_map_single to create the mapping (orig_addr)
> was after the requested address for the sync (tlb_offset) in the
> same block:
>
> |------------------------------------------| block
> <----------------------------> mapped part of the block
> ^
> orig_addr
> ^
> invalid tlb_addr for sync
>
> - if the resulting offset was bigger than the allocation size
> this one could happen if the mapping was not until the end. e.g.
>
> |------------------------------------------| block
> <---------------------> mapped part of the block
> ^ ^
> orig_addr invalid tlb_addr
>
> Both should never happen so print a warning and bail out without trying
> to adjust the sizes/offsets: the first one could try to sync from
> orig_addr to whatever is left of the requested size, but the later
> really has nothing to sync there...
